Comprehensive Analysis of HomeFitnessCode: Company Profile, Products, and Market Position
The home fitness equipment market has been experiencing rapid growth, with significant acceleration during the pandemic and continued expansion in post-pandemic times. HomeFitnessCode, a relatively new player in this industry, has established a presence in the budget-friendly segment of the market, specializing in walking pads and under-desk treadmills. This detailed analysis examines the company’s structure, product offerings, market position, and customer reception.
Company Background and Structure
HomeFitnessCode Ltd is a relatively young company in the fitness equipment industry, officially registered as a UK private limited company. The company was incorporated on January 5, 2021, with company number 13114548. Its registered office is located at Unit 39 St Olavs Court City Business Center, Lower Road, London, England, SE16 2XB. The company operates under the SIC code 47990, which represents “Other retail sale not in stores, stalls or markets”.
Leadership and Ownership
The company has undergone significant changes in its leadership and ownership structure since its incorporation:
- Initial Director: Chaowei Xu (resigned on March 19, 2021)
- Current Director: Yiqun Zhong (appointed on March 19, 2021)
- Current Person with Significant Control: Hongkong Xzy Science and Technology Limited (established on August 10, 2023)
- Previous Person with Significant Control: Yiqun Zhong (ceased on August 10, 2023)
This transition suggests that the company has ties to Chinese ownership, particularly with the Hong Kong-based parent company now controlling significant interests. This is further evidenced by the contact information on their French website, which lists:
“Hongkong XZY Science And Technology Ltd Unit 02, 21/F, Heep Kwan Commercial Building 38 Bee Street, Yau Ma Tei Kowloon, Hong Kong”
Financial Status
As a relatively new company, HomeFitnessCode’s financial information is limited in public records. The company is classified as “micro” sized according to UK standards, with:
- Turnover: Under €632,000
- Balance Sheet: Under €632,000
- Employees: Under 10
The company’s latest financial filing with Companies House indicates “Total exemption full accounts” for the period ending January 31, 2024. While specific revenue figures aren’t publicly disclosed, the company operates in the rapidly growing global home fitness equipment market, valued between $11.60-15.31 billion in 2023.
Business Model and Operations
Product Portfolio
HomeFitnessCode specializes in compact home fitness equipment, with a primary focus on walking pads and under-desk treadmills. Their product lineup includes various models with different features and price points:
- Walking Pads (basic models):
- Speed ranges typically from 0.6-6.2mph
- Compact design for under-desk use
- LED displays and remote controls
- Priced from €118.99-€159.99
- Premium Walking Pads with Enhanced Features:
- Models with incline features (up to 5%)
- Expanded speed ranges (up to 10km/h)
- Brushless motors for quieter operation (<35dB)
- Priced from €179.99-€199.99
- Folding Treadmills:
- 2-in-1 functionality (walking pad and traditional treadmill)
- Speeds up to 12km/h
- Widened running belts
- Priced from €179.99-€289.99
Value Proposition
HomeFitnessCode’s business model centers around several key value propositions:
- Affordability: “We make our best to reduce the manufacturing cost while keeping the quality, to make sure our equipment is affordable for most people”
- Quality-to-Price Ratio: The company positions itself as offering professional-grade equipment at accessible price points
- Space Efficiency: Products are designed to be compact, portable, and suitable for small living spaces
- Convenience: Focus on no-assembly or minimal-assembly products that can be used immediately
Distribution and Marketing
HomeFitnessCode employs multiple channels to reach customers:
- E-commerce: Primary sales through their own website (homefitnesscode.com) and third-party platforms like Amazon Marketplace
- Affiliate Marketing: The company runs an affiliate program offering 10% commission per sale with a 30-day cookie duration, targeting fitness influencers and content creators
- Promotional Strategy: Heavy reliance on discounting, with products regularly shown at “reduced” prices (up to 35% off)
- Regional Variations: The company maintains region-specific websites (.com, .co.uk, .fr) to target different markets with localized content

Market Analysis and Competitive Landscape
Market Size and Growth
HomeFitnessCode operates in the rapidly expanding global home fitness equipment market:
- Current Market Valuation: $11.60-15.31 billion (2023)
- Projected Growth: Expected to reach $18.94-24.57 billion by 2032
- CAGR: 5.3-5.8% growth rate anticipated over the forecast period
This growth is driven by:
- Increasing health awareness among consumers
- Rising preference for at-home workout solutions
- Technological innovations in fitness equipment
- Changing work patterns (including remote work) increasing demand for desk exercise solutions
Competitive Positioning
HomeFitnessCode positions itself in the budget to mid-range segment of the walking pad/under-desk treadmill market, competing with several established and emerging brands:
- WalkingPad: A more established competitor with models ranging from $349-$949, offering premium features like dual-folding designs (A1 Pro) and higher build quality
- UREVO: Known for good cushioning and quiet operation, with the Strol 2E Smart Treadmill offering speeds up to 7.6mph for under $370
- MERACH: Budget-friendly option with the T21 model priced under $300, featuring shock-absorbing silicone layers
- LifeSpan: Premium brand with the TR1200-GlowUp model noted for exceptionally quiet operation
- Sunny Health & Fitness: WalkStation Slim model offers compact design at competitive pricing
HomeFitnessCode’s main competitive advantages include:
- More affordable pricing compared to premium brands
- Diverse product range with various features and price points
- Focus on space-saving designs suitable for home/office environments
- Comparable features to mid-range competitors at lower price points
Customer Reviews and Product Quality
Customer Satisfaction
Customer feedback for HomeFitnessCode products shows mixed but generally positive sentiment:
- BritainReviews: Indicates an 85% would-buy-again rate across 20 reviews
- Fakespot’s Analysis: Of Amazon reviews suggests approximately 80% are high-quality, with customers particularly praising the compact size and build quality
Common Praise Points
Customers frequently highlight several positive aspects of HomeFitnessCode products:
- Compact Size: “Customers are thrilled with the compact size of the HomeFitnessCode Walking Pad, praising its ease of storage and portability”
- Build Quality: “Customers are highly satisfied with the high quality build of the under desk treadmill. They find it to be impressive, sturdy, and excellent value for money”
- Incline Feature: The 5% incline option is appreciated for enhancing workout intensity
- Value: Many reviews mention satisfaction with the price-to-quality ratio
- Delivery: Quick delivery times are frequently mentioned as a positive aspect
Common Criticisms
However, several recurring issues appear in customer reviews:
- Quality Inconsistencies: Some customers report product failures or defects requiring replacement
- Customer Service Challenges: “I got in touch with the company, and they told me to try and fix it. I wasn’t happy about that”
- Noise Issues: Some models develop noise problems after extended use
- Documentation: “One thing that was a bit disappointing about the purchase was the lack of helpful information or instructions”

Conclusion
HomeFitnessCode represents a relatively new but growing player in the home fitness equipment market, specifically targeting the budget to mid-range segment of walking pads and under-desk treadmills. Incorporated in the UK in 2021 with apparent ties to Chinese manufacturing, the company has quickly established a presence through competitive pricing, space-efficient product designs, and strategic marketing.
The company operates in a rapidly growing market projected to reach nearly $25 billion by 2032, competing with both established premium brands and fellow budget-oriented manufacturers. While customer feedback indicates generally positive reception regarding value and design, there are some recurring concerns about quality consistency and customer service.
As the home fitness equipment market continues to evolve, HomeFitnessCode’s success will likely depend on balancing their affordable pricing with improvements in product quality, customer support, and brand recognition in an increasingly competitive landscape.
